亚马逊云服务器搭建教程,亚马逊云服务器搭建教程,从零开始,轻松构建高效云平台
- 综合资讯
- 2024-11-23 14:23:34
- 2

从零开始,本教程详细讲解亚马逊云服务器搭建,轻松构建高效云平台。涵盖基础知识、操作步骤及优化技巧,助你快速掌握云服务器搭建技能。...
从零开始,本教程详细讲解亚马逊云服务器搭建,轻松构建高效云平台。涵盖基础知识、操作步骤及优化技巧,助你快速掌握云服务器搭建技能。
随着云计算技术的飞速发展,越来越多的企业和个人开始将业务迁移到云端,亚马逊云服务(Amazon Web Services,简称AWS)作为全球领先的云服务提供商,拥有丰富的产品线和稳定的服务质量,本文将为您详细讲解如何在亚马逊云服务器上搭建一个高效、稳定的云平台。
准备工作
1、注册AWS账号:您需要在AWS官网注册一个账号,注册成功后,您将获得一个免费的AWS账户,并可以享受一定时间的免费资源。
2、准备必要的工具:在搭建过程中,您需要使用以下工具:
- 计算机一台,安装有浏览器和命令行工具(如Git、SSH等);
- AWS CLI(Amazon Web Services Command Line Interface):用于通过命令行与AWS服务进行交互;
- Terraform:一款基础设施即代码的工具,可以帮助您自动化部署和管理AWS资源。
搭建步骤
1、安装AWS CLI和Terraform
(1)安装AWS CLI:访问AWS CLI官网,下载适用于您操作系统的安装包,根据提示完成安装。
(2)配置AWS CLI:打开命令行工具,运行以下命令配置AWS CLI:
aws configure
按照提示输入您的AWS账号信息(Access Key、Secret Access Key和默认区域)。
(3)安装Terraform:访问Terraform官网,下载适用于您操作系统的安装包,根据提示完成安装。
2、编写Terraform配置文件
(1)创建一个名为“terraform”的文件夹,用于存放Terraform配置文件。
(2)在“terraform”文件夹中,创建一个名为“main.tf”的文件,用于定义AWS资源,以下是一个简单的示例:
provider "aws" { region = "us-west-2" } resource "aws_instance" "example" { ami = "ami-0c55b159cbfafe1f0" # 根据您的需求选择合适的AMI instance_type = "t2.micro" key_name = "example-key-pair" }
(3)在“terraform”文件夹中,创建一个名为“variables.tf”的文件,用于定义可变参数,以下是一个简单的示例:
variable "region" { description = "AWS region" type = string default = "us-west-2" } variable "ami" { description = "AMI ID" type = string default = "ami-0c55b159cbfafe1f0" } variable "instance_type" { description = "Instance type" type = string default = "t2.micro" } variable "key_name" { description = "Key pair name" type = string default = "example-key-pair" }
3、初始化Terraform
在“terraform”文件夹中,运行以下命令初始化Terraform:
terraform init
这将下载必要的插件和AWS CLI配置。
4、配置AWS密钥对
(1)在AWS管理控制台中,进入“密钥对”页面。
(2)点击“创建密钥对”,填写密钥对名称,然后点击“创建”。
(3)下载密钥对文件,并保存到本地。
5、创建AWS资源
在“terraform”文件夹中,运行以下命令创建AWS资源:
terraform apply
按照提示输入“yes”确认创建资源,Terraform将为您创建一个AWS实例,并在控制台输出实例信息。
6、连接到AWS实例
(1)使用SSH客户端连接到AWS实例,以下是连接到Windows系统的命令:
ssh -i "path/to/your/private-key.pem" ec2-user@<instance-public-ip>
(2)使用SSH客户端连接到AWS实例,以下是连接到Linux系统的命令:
ssh -i "path/to/your/private-key.pem" ec2-user@<instance-public-ip>
path/to/your/private-key.pem
是您下载的密钥对文件路径,<instance-public-ip>
是AWS实例的公网IP地址。
7、配置实例
(1)登录到AWS实例后,根据您的需求进行配置,如安装必要的软件、配置网络等。
(2)完成配置后,您就可以使用AWS实例进行相应的业务操作了。
通过以上步骤,您已经成功在亚马逊云服务器上搭建了一个高效、稳定的云平台,在后续的使用过程中,您可以根据实际需求调整Terraform配置文件,以便更好地管理AWS资源,祝您使用愉快!
本文链接:https://www.zhitaoyun.cn/1026593.html
发表评论